Overview

Hilton Head Island is a town in United States.

About 41,000 people live here and it hugs the shoreline at low elevation.

It lies in the northern hemisphere, in North America.

The nearest airport is Hilton Head Airport (HHH), about 5 km away.

Best time to visit

The climate here is broadly subtropical (northern hemisphere): mild winters and hot summers.

For most visitors the shoulder seasons — roughly April to June and September to October — offer warm-enough weather without the peak-summer crowds, while high summer (June to August) is busiest.

Being on the water softens the extremes compared with places inland.
